Giuseppe Lo Vasco
Restaurant Manager IGNIV
Why did you decide to work at Badrutt’s
Palace Hotel and which was the first position
you held here?

When I graduated from hotel school in Italy my aunt recommended
I apply to the 5 star hotels in St. Moritz. Just when I had almost lost hope
of getting a job I heard from Badrutt’s Palace Hotel and they offered me
the position of Commis de Rang in Le Grand Hall.
Talk us through your career

My first job at Badrutt’ s Palace Hotel was Commis de Rang in Le Grand Hall on 17 December 2010. Later, I was promoted to Demi-Chef de Rang and then to Chef de Rang. Through the Palace network I was able to work a summer in Zurich and while there, I improved my German. Then I had the chance to become part of Andreas Caminada’s IGNIV team. The Palace enabled me to undertake further training at the Academy of Hotel Excellence and I could also gain work experience last Spring in Japan. Now I am Restaurant Manager in IGNIV and thanks to the hotel’s faith in me, I can work in summer at Schloss Schauenstein with Andreas Caminada and in winter at the Palace in St. Moritz.

Sara Balatti
FLOOR SUPERVISOR
Why did you decide to work at Badrutt’s
Palace Hotel and which was the first position
you held here?

I had always wanted to work in a large prestigious hotel known for its
hospitality and impeccable service. Badrutt’s Palace Hotel was my first
choice and I was extremely happy to start working here
as a chamber maid.
Talk us through your career

On my first day at work I was both nervous and excited, two emotions which proved very useful. Being open and alert enabled me to learn fast and learn more than I ever imagined. It very soon became clear that chamber maid work is far more than just cleaning: it is about having an eye for detail, understanding and anticipating the guests’ needs. Working for a company which offers training and promotion opportunities encouraged me to plan my future. After completing a Progresso course I am now Floor Supervisor and I have discovered a job in which I am happy and satisfied and which I enjoy doing.
